Where to Use This Design Carefully

No design is perfect for every surface, and this one has some considerations. The galaxy theme works best on medium to dark fabric backgrounds where the depth of the design can really show. On a light fabric, you may lose some of the cosmic feel unless you adjust thread colors to be darker or more saturated. I also suggest being careful with small hoop sizes. If you are working with a 4x4 hoop, you will need to scale the design down significantly, and that may cause small details to blur together. For curved surfaces like caps or the side of a tumbler itself, the tapered version of this wrap is a better starting point. The straight version works well on flat surfaces like tote bags, pillow covers, and tea towels. If you are embroidering on a sweatshirt or a blanket, make sure the fabric is not too thin or too stretchy, or you may get puckering around the stitch areas. A good quality cutaway stabilizer is your friend here. I also recommend testing the design in black and white first to see which areas carry the most visual weight. That simple step can save you from a disappointing finished product.
